Ticket: The credential used by Spokeshift, our bike-share rebalancing tool, expired Tuesday night, so the nightly dock-capacity sync against the Fleetline inventory service has been failing silently. No rider impact yet, but rebalancing crews are working from stale data. I've provisioned a replacement credential with the same scopes and a 90-day rotation reminder. Deploying the config update after the sync meeting. For reference, the new key is included below.

app token of yajeg-kawef = kto11_7En3XSX8xQw

TICKET: Connection pool exhaustion under burst load

The Marrowbend reporting service is exhausting its database connection pool during hourly export bursts, causing timeouts downstream. Proposed fix: raise the pool ceiling from 40 to 80, add idle-connection reaping at 90 seconds, and emit pool-saturation metrics. Change is low risk but touches shared infrastructure config, so it needs sign-off at this week's eng sync. Approval rests with the engineer named below.

approver of yajef-fajef = Oliwyn Silion Kasok Kasox

**Ticket #918 — ChipTrack vault won't open**

Hi support — the Ridgefen Marathon timing-chip reader lost power mid-race and its config vault relocked. Split times are safe on the SD card, but live results are frozen until we unseal. Grab the handheld, hold SYNC for five seconds, and enter the recovery passphrase shown below.

unlock words, yawig-kagef: gordor-holvan-ulaael-pramir-ulaiel-tamdor

Audit item 7: Offline mode, Fernwick field-survey app

Verify that surveys captured offline are queued locally, encrypted at rest, and synced once connectivity returns, with no silent data loss on conflict. Contractors should test airplane-mode capture on at least two device types and record results in the audit sheet. Findings and sign-off requests go to the feature owner named below.

named custodian: Brivan Eliath Quenox Frador